Frequently asked questions about lead practitioner of statistics pay in Rayleigh

How much does a lead practitioner of statistics earn in Rayleigh?

The average salary for a lead practitioner of statistics in Rayleigh is £47,500 per year, typically ranging from £38,950 per year to £57,950 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Rayleigh a well-paid area for lead practitioner of statisticss?

Rayleigh t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for lead practitioner of statisticss.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

How can a lead practitioner of statistics in Rayleigh increase their salary?

Lead Practitioner of Statisticss in Rayleigh typically increase pay by moving up MPS/UPS + TLR where applicable,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.

What's the difference between lead practitioner of statistics pay in Rayleigh and nationally?

Nationally the average is £50,000 per year. In Rayleigh it's £47,500 per year — a discount of £2,500 per year versus the UK average.
